Ras Al Khaimah Goes After Indian Tourists

The northern emirate of Ras Al Khaimah has its eyes on India for inbound tourism. That on its own isn’t new – just about everyone wants to tap into India’s growing middle class. But in doing so, RAK could chip away at Dubai’s largest source market.

India's Surge in Destination Weddings - India Report

Over 80% of Indians have either had or are planning a destination wedding, a survey conducted by search aggregator Skyscanner showed. This preference is strongest among Gen Z, with about 50% of that group indicating that they are considering a destination wedding. This figure is 33% among Millennials.

Sri Lanka Rolls Out Free 30-Day Tourist Visas for 35 Nations

Sri Lanka is set to launch a six-month pilot program on October 1, offering free 30-day tourist visas on arrival to citizens from 35 countries, including the U.S., UK, Russia, India and China. The initiative, which temporarily waives the typical $50 visa fee, aligns with the island nation’s peak travel season, lasting from December to mid-April. This move is part of a broader strategy to revitalize tourism, a sector crucial to Sri Lanka’s economy.
